The goal of breast cancer surgery is to excise the tumor and a portion of the surrounding tissues while conserving the breast. Breast cancer surgery methods may vary in the amount of breast tissue which is removed with the tumor. This depends on the overall tumor location, how far it has spread, as well as one’s personal feelings. The surgeons also remove some lymph nodes under this arm so that these can be removed. This helps your doctor to plan your treatment.

Minimally invasive surgery and open surgery are two ways of doing cancer surgery. In open surgery, a large incision is made to remove the tumor. In minimally invasive surgery, surgeons make a few small cuts to remove the tumor. The common techniques for minimally invasive surgery are laser surgery, cryosurgery, robotic surgery, laparoscopy, cryosurgery.

What does a surgical oncologist do?

A surgical oncologist is a doctor who removes the tumor and adjacent tissues through surgery. They also perform some types of biopsies to diagnose cancer. A surgical oncologist performs surgeries to know which parts of the body cancer has spread. In order to diagnose cancer, a surgical oncologist might perform biopsies. After a biopsy, a surgical oncologist sends the samples to a pathologist. If cancer is detected, you may need to consult the surgical oncologist again to have the tumor removed. The surgical oncologist performs a staging surgery to determine a tumor’s size.

When should you go to see a surgical oncologist?

If your primary doctor suspects cancer, he will refer you to a surgical oncologist for the diagnosis of the condition. The surgical oncologist evaluates the symptoms and analyses the test report to find out if you have cancer. Consider seeking assistance from a surgical oncologist in the below-listed situations:

  1. Unusual cancer like head or neck cancer.
  2. Complex cancer can spread to multiple body parts.
  3. Cancer recurrence
  4. Cancer that is difficult to treat
  5. For in-depth evaluation and treatment plan
  6. You want a second opinion about cancer diagnosis
